It is with saddened hearts that we announce the passing of our beloved husband, father, grampy, brother and uncle, Lawrence Vickers, on Thursday, September 6, 2018, surrounded by his loving family in the comfort of his home.
Born in Sydney Mines November 5, 1946, he was the son of the Late Kenneth and Agnes (Reid) Vickers.
Lawrence will be forever remembered by his wife and soul mate of 42 years, Joyce; his daughter, Laura Lee (Daniel) Allain, and son, Kenneth (Carroll) Vickers. ”Grampy” will be lovingly remembered by his six grandchildren, Benjamin, Kennedy, Jade, Jasper, William and Jordie; by his sister, Frances Boyd, and brothers, Tom (Irene), Earl, and Donald; his brothers and sisters-in-law, Marlie (Lawrence) Norman, Arlie (Sharon) Forrest, Davey (Mildred) Forrest, Renie (George) Mills, Vivian Forrest (Kathy), Nancy (Dale ) Harrietha, Wanda (Murray) Jessome, Peter (Rossie) Forrest, Marie (Warren) Nicholson, Lisa (Brian) Matthews, Glen Forrest, Jody (Tracey) Forrest, Johnny Gibbons, William Rogers, Morris Gracie and his many nieces and nephews.
He was predeceased by his parents and sisters, Bunny Gracie, Gail Rogers and Sandra Gibbons; his mother and father-in-law, Nettie and Jordie Forrest and sister-in-law, Willena Vickers.
Lawrence worked at the Sydney Steel Plant for 25 years before retiring in 2000 and joining his son in his carpentry business. He will be fondly remembered for his love of all sports but particularly his love of hockey and the Detroit Red Wings. Lawrence loved to fish the Margaree River, spend time with his family in Boisdale, and fiddle with his many projects.
